Filters:
Country:
Region:
Similar words:
used computer store in Northwich Cheshire
About 30 results.
First Choice - Warrington
Buttermarket Street, WA1 2LY Warrington, United KingdomThe home of All Inclusive. Download the MyFirstChoice app as your perfect travel companion http://www.firstchoice.co.uk/myapp/